Pros

Flexi schedule- 10-4pm, free lunch every monday, free clothing, cool people, cool office.

Cons

horrible training on digesting company sales data- which is an intergral part of the job. the management gatekeeps info, lack of communication from above, everyone works by themselves, even if you are designing the same brand. output expectations are unreasonable- you will be working till 3-4am on an unrealistic deadline, and there is a ton of wasted work.

Pros

The company was growing pretty fast and had a startup like pace, until the tariffs happened. SHEIN’s pace slowed down a lot and the company pivoted to cost optimization

Cons

1) company’s leadership, especially the US leadership lacks vision and creates a toxic work culture by constantly belittling people in open and yelling at them. 2) the small group of top leaders almost behave like high school bullies colluding with each other 3) you’ll struggle to survive, let alone succeed, if you don’t speak Chinese. 4) Sheins compensation is significantly below industry peers 5) Daily late night calls with the China team mean a non existent work life balance. You are expected to be available at all times, including late night and weekends
